The size of Herdsmans Cove is approximately 0.9 square kilometres. It has 3 parks covering nearly 37.0% of total area. The population of Herdsmans Cove in 2016 was 1120 people. By 2021 the population was 1199 showing a population growth of 7.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Herdsmans Cove is 0-9 years. Households in Herdsmans Cove are primarily single parents and are likely to be repaying $600 - $799 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Herdsmans Cove work in a community and personal service occupation.In 2021, 31.20% of the homes in Herdsmans Cove were owner-occupied compared with 29.20% in 2016.
